Kingsland Minerals Ltd. Business Overview & Revenue Model

Company DescriptionKingsland Minerals Ltd. (KNG) is a mineral exploration company focused on the discovery and development of mineral resources. Operating primarily in the mining sector, the company is engaged in the exploration and potential development of various mineral properties, with a particular interest in resources such as gold, uranium, and copper. With projects located in Australia and the Northern Territory, Kingsland Minerals Ltd. aims to leverage its expertise in geology and mining to identify and develop economically viable mineral deposits.

Kingsland Minerals Ltd. Corporate Events

Kingsland Minerals Advances Leliyn Graphite Project with Resource Update and Testing
Apr 24, 2025

Kingsland Minerals Ltd. has released its March 2025 quarterly report, highlighting the update of Indicated Mineral Resources for the Leliyn Graphite Project. This update follows an infill drilling program completed in late 2024 and will serve as the foundation for a scoping study into producing fine flake graphite concentrate at the site. Additionally, the company dispatched a 5kg sample of graphite concentrate to ProGraphite GmbH in Germany for advanced metallurgical testing, which will evaluate the potential for producing spherical, purified graphite, a crucial component for electric vehicle and storage batteries.

Kingsland Minerals Announces Significant Graphite Resource at Leliyn Project
Apr 8, 2025

Kingsland Minerals Ltd has announced a maiden Indicated Resource of 1 million tonnes of contained graphite at its Leliyn Graphite Project in the Northern Territory. This development will support a scoping study for a potential mining operation, with the aim of establishing a significant graphite production facility. The high conversion rate from Inferred to Indicated Resource suggests strong potential for future resource upgrades, which could enhance the project’s viability. The company is also testing a bulk sample of graphite concentrate in Germany, which will be used to assess the feasibility of producing purified spherical graphite, further positioning Kingsland as a key player in the graphite supply chain.

Kingsland Minerals Advances Leliyn Graphite Project with Key Testing Phase
Mar 5, 2025

Kingsland Minerals Ltd has dispatched a bulk sample of graphite concentrate from its Leliyn Graphite Project to Germany for advanced metallurgical testing. This step is crucial for producing purified, spherical graphite, which will support economic studies and a scoping study for potential graphite mining and processing operations. The company is strategically positioned to benefit from the US’s efforts to reduce reliance on Chinese speciality metals, as recent USITC findings could lead to increased tariffs on Chinese graphite imports.

Kingsland Minerals Secures Key Investment and Strategic Agreement
Jan 30, 2025

Kingsland Minerals Ltd. announced a significant investment of $2.56 million by Quinbrook Infrastructure Partners, which now holds a 15.3% stake in the company. The investment includes agreements for the off-take of graphite concentrate and potential renewable energy provision for Kingsland’s Leliyn Graphite Project, marking a crucial step in the company’s commercial strategy.
